      <description>Hello,&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I have a performance problem with an Linux (SuSE8.0) NFS server and a HP-UX 10.20 client. If I try to copy 100 small files (200 Bytes each) from the HP-UX client disc to the Linux NFS server, this takes 25 seconds for the copy and 23 seconds for a rm command. With an HP-UX NFS server and HP-UX client it takes 3.5 seconds. I now about the NFS problem with small files, but is there a way to tune the HP-UX/Linux connection to HP-UX/HP-UX speed ? (or faster)&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;thanks and regards&lt;BR /&gt;Rolf Alfke</description>

      <description>The only advice I have is to have the latest nfs release and all patches on the HP client side.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;The NFS components with Suse Linux are probably up to date.  The NFS component(client) for HP-UX 10.20 is nearly a decade out of date.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;This could be a contributing factor to the problem.  If you have an HP-UX 11.x box with latest NFS and patches, are the numbers better?&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;SEP</description>

      <description>Do the command nfsstat -c check if you have timeouts.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;In your mount command from your HP-UX client set the rsize and wsize buffer size to 8192.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;i.e. &l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;mount -F nfs -o rsize=8192,wsize=8192 linux:/mnt/export /mnt&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Regards&lt;BR /&gt;  Roland&lt;BR /&gt;</description>

      <description>Thanks for the tips.&lt;BR /&gt;I checked it with a HP-UX11.11 Client. This used 1.2 seconds. I then checked a S700 HP-UX 10.20 machine with newer patches installed. This gave an acceptabel result of 3.5 seconds. So I downloaded the latest Patch bundle for my S800 machine, patched only the nfs software and the result is 3.5 seconds now. This is ok I think.&lt;BR /&gt;Thanks again&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;rolf&lt;BR /&gt;</description>
